Topographic Map of LaCrosse County
- Image
- View Full Item
- Created Date
- 1931
- Description
Relief shown by contours and spot heights. Maps shows United States, state, county and local highways and roads, schools, North Bend, creeks, lakes, rivers, Decorah Prairie, Maiden Rock, Butman Corners, Cox Hill, Wittville, Council Bay, parks, bluffs, railroads, Wadels Hill, Twin Peaks, Upper Burns, Walness Hill, chutes, sloughs, County Asylum, valleys, ridges, cemeteries, Grand Crossing, Cold Springs, islands, Poor Farm, churches. The lower left corner of the map has a key showing roads in red and black, and icons in red, black, and blue.
